Output 63ae1bc2dbfd92eec0b138307dcb404a5fa50cc43d920e007d7ecc66abd0192a:55

value
21212083
script pubkey
OP_0 OP_PUSHBYTES_20 38d012376e2f70379bf68aa49eb1cc0c0869c479
address
bc1q8rgpydmw9acr0xlk32jfavwvpsyxn3rekwv36u
transaction
63ae1bc2dbfd92eec0b138307dcb404a5fa50cc43d920e007d7ecc66abd0192a
spent
true